in part says: No matter your drug of choice—chemical, horsepower,
audio—with prolonged use, you always reach a plateau at which you
believe you just can’t get any higher. But sooner or later, something
else enters your reality that restarts the cycle, and you’re off and
running again. Such is my experience with the Pass Labs XA160.5
monoblocks.
If you are new to the world of high-end audio, you can get the condensed history of Pass Labs here: http://www.passlabs.com/about.htm.
The shorter version is simple: Nelson Pass is a genius. He’s probably
got more patents for amplifier design than almost everyone else combined. And
he’s got a great sense of humor, too. The owner’s manual describes the
new amplifier as “tending to run heavy and hot, but elicit high
performance and reliability from simple circuits.”
Weighing in at about 130 pounds each and $24,000 per pair, the
XA160.5s are not for the light of wallet—or bicep. Or, for that matter,
air-conditioning capacity. The power draw isn’t huge, but each unit
sucks 600 watts from the power line, whether idling or at full power.
Because they only produce 160 watts per channel into 8 ohms, doubling
into a 4-ohm load, they get very warm to the touch. Yes, this behavior
is normal for a class A design. The extra heat was welcome in March when
the amplifiers arrived, as it kept our studio toasty. Yet, as days got
longer, the amps forced us to run the A/C well before we normally would.

It’s always tough to make comparisons, yet the XA160.5 combines the
virtues of my three favorite amplifiers into one (actually two) boxes:
the delicacy of the Wavac EC300B, the texture and dimensionality of the
ARC REF 150, and the power, control, and composure of the Burmester
911s.
Independent of the “B” word, the Pass Labs XA160.5 monoblocks orbit
the top stratosphere of amplifier design at any price. If you would like
that je ne sais quoi that you thought required a vacuum-tube
amplifier, these are a consummate alternative. There is nothing that the
XA160.5s do not do.
